How to remove virus with PC Tools AntiVirus?

PC Tools AntiVirus' scan function is capable of conducting a system-wide scan of files on your computer for the presence of infected or suspicious objects. Infected objects are those that are known to contain virus or related malware code. On the other hand, suspicious objects are those which contain code that is either modified or reminiscent to that of a virus or related malware.

When the scanner finds an infected object, PC Tools AntiVirus first attempts to disinfect it. If the object cannot be disinfected, it is either quarantined or removed, depending on the 'Action to be performed on a detected object' option selected on the Settings -> Scan Settings screen.

Step 1 - Select Scan Style

Full Scan

This function conducts a comprehensive scan of all files on the computer, based on the options selected on the Settings -> Scan Settings screen.

To start an immediate Full Scan, click the Scan Your Computer button on the Main Status screen.

Alternatively, complete the following steps:
    1. Click the Scan button on the left of the interface.

    2. Under "Select Scan Type", ensure that "Full Scan" is selected.

    3. Click the Start Scan button to start the Full Scan.

Custom Scan

To commence a Custom Scan, complete the following steps:
    1. Click the Scan button on the left of the interface.

    2. Under "Select Scan Type", ensure that "Custom Scan" is selected to display the Custom Scan Selection on the right.

    3. Choose all the files and objects to scan in the Custom Scan by selecting or clearing the appropriate check boxes.

    4. Click the Start Scan button to start the Custom Scan.



Step 2 - Scanning your computer

The Scanning screen is displayed during the progression of a scan. A progress bar increments from left to right as PC Tools AntiVirus scans the computer. The animated graphic of files being scanned indicates that the scanning process is still active. Any files that PC Tools AntiVirus is capable of disinfecting are automatically disinfected.

The following information is displayed on the Scanning screen:
    Scan progress - Indicates the percentage of the entire scan that has been completed.

    Virus definitions - Indicates the total number of virus definitions being used in the scan. This is the same as the number indicated on the Main Status screen.

    Items processed - Indicates the total number of files and objects that have been scanned.

    Infections found - Indicates the total number of infected files or objects that have been detected in the scan.

To stop the scan at any time, click the Stop Scan button.

Step 3 - Remove

If you have selected 'Prompt Me' for either a 'Suspicious object' or 'Infected object' for the 'Action to be performed on a detected object' option on the Settings -> Scan Settings screen, you are prompted to perform an action on any suspicious or infected files or objects detected during the scan. When the prompt displays, you can select:
    Quarantine - This places the suspicious or infected object into quarantine, where it can be recovered later through the Quarantine screen.

    Remove - This deletes the suspicious or infected object from the computer. Note: Deleted objects cannot be recovered.

    Selecting the 'Don't prompt me again during this session' check box before clicking either Quarantine or Remove performs the selected action on any subsequent detections for the remainder of the current scan.

Please Note: If you do not click either Quarantine or Remove on a given prompt within 20 seconds, the infection is automatically quarantined.

When PC Tools AntiVirus has finished scanning your system, the Scan results screen displays.
